Marble floor regrouting services involve removing old, deteriorated grout from between marble tiles and replacing it with fresh, durable material. This process helps restore the appearance of the flooring, making the marble look cleaner and more polished. Regrouting can also improve the overall stability of the tiles, preventing them from shifting or becoming loose over time. Skilled contractors use specialized tools and techniques to ensure the new grout is properly applied, sealed, and matched to the existing marble for a seamless look.
This service is especially valuable for addressing common problems such as stained, cracked, or crumbling grout that detracts from the beauty of marble floors. Over time, grout can absorb dirt, spills, and moisture, leading to discoloration and potential damage to the underlying tiles. Regrouting helps eliminate these issues, reducing the risk of water infiltration and mold growth in the joints. It also provides an opportunity to repair any damaged or missing grout, which can prevent further deterioration and extend the lifespan of the flooring.

The overview below groups typical Marble Floor Regrouting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Payson, AZ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or regrouting of small sections or touch-ups,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the size of the area and the condition of the grout.
Moderate Projects - Regrouting larger floor areas or multiple rooms generally costs between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common and often involve standard-sized spaces with typical grout issues.
Larger, Complex Jobs - Extensive regrouting for large or intricate marble installations can range from $1,500 to $3,000. Fewer projects reach into this tier, usually due to the complexity or size of the area.
Full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of old grout or damaged marble sections can exceed $3,000, with larger or more detailed projects reaching $5,000 or more. Such jobs are less frequent but necessary for significant restorations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is marble floor regrouting? Marble floor regrouting involves removing old, damaged grout lines and replacing them to improve the appearance and integrity of the marble surface.
Why should I consider regrouting my marble floors? Regrouting can help prevent water damage, reduce staining, and restore the marble's original look by filling in gaps and cracks in the grout lines.
How do local contractors prepare for marble regrouting? Professionals typically assess the condition of the existing grout, carefully clean the surface, and use specialized tools and materials to ensure a durable finish.
Is regrouting suitable for all types of marble floors? Regrouting is generally appropriate for most marble surfaces, especially when grout lines are cracked, stained, or deteriorated, but a local expert can evaluate specific cases.
What signs indicate that marble regrouting might be needed? Visible cracks, missing grout, discoloration, or water seepage are common signs that regrouting services may be beneficial for your marble floors.
